Haa Dhaalu Atoll, Maldives
Quick answer
Kulhudhuffushi is the economic and commercial capital of the northern Maldives, often called the "Heart of the North". The island is famous for its unique mangrove lake (Kulhudhuffushi Kulhi) and traditional coir rope weaving.
